ELECTRODEPOSITION GRINDING WHEEL, MANUFACTURE OF ELECTRODEPOSITION GRINDING WHEEL AND ABRASIVE GRAIN ARRANGING DEVICE

PROBLEM TO BE SOLVED: To reduce a fluctuation in an abrasive grain diameter by providing a temporarily attaching layer existing on tool base metal, an abrasive grain group by arranging abrasive grains as a layer in this temporarily attaching layer and a plating layer to fix this abrasive grain group. SOLUTION: Abrasive grains 1 are fixed on tool base metal 2 by plating 3 after applying a temporarily attaching material 4 to the tool base metal 2. Silicone and a resist conductive adhesive can be used as the temporarily attaching material 4 so that abrasive grain arrangement is completed before completely solidifying the temporarily attaching material 4. The abrasive grains 1 are fixed to the tool base metal 2 by the plating 3 after performing heat treatment and conductive processing according to handling of the temporarily attaching material 4. A grinding wheel having the excellently uniformed abrasive grain tip is obtained by arranging the abrasive grains 1 held in a temporarily attaching layer (the temporarily attaching material 4) as a layer so that a fluctuation in a grain diameter falls within about 5 percent. The plating may be fixed on the tool base metal by tearing off the plating and the abrasive grains 1 from the temporarily attaching material 4 by fixing the abrasive grains 1 to the plating by performing plating processing after temporarily attaching the abrasive grains 1 to the temporarily attaching material 4.
